Mitchell and Mitsibushi Ki 57
Description
Four photographs from an album.
#1 is the nose of a B-25 Mitchell, annotated 'Veteran Mitchell at Mingladon'. It has large numbers of operations on the nose and a scantily clad woman.
#2 is the nose of a Ki 57.
#3 and 4 are port side views of a Ki 57 annotated 'Jap surrender envoys kite at Mingladon'.
